BLS metro-level wage data places Gambling Surveillance Officers and Gambling Investigators pay in Northeastern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area at a median of $36,210 per year ($17.41/hr/hour), drawn from the OEWS May 2025 release for this Metropolitan Statistical Area. Compared to the national median of $43,370, Northeastern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area pays 17% below, which typically tracks with a lower local cost of living or smaller specialized-employer cluster. Approximately 90 gambling surveillance officers and gambling investigatorss are employed across the Northeastern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area MSA in SOC 33-9031.
The Northeastern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area pay distribution spans from $30,830 at the 10th percentile to $48,350 at the 90th — a 1.6× spread that reflects experience tenure, specialization, employer size, and the difference between public-sector, nonprofit, and private-sector compensation inside the metro. The 25th percentile sits at $34,310 and the 75th at $46,070, so half of Northeastern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area-based gambling surveillance officers and gambling investigatorss earn within that middle band.

Remember that OEWS wages reflect base pay only: employer-provided health insurance, retirement matches, stock options, signing bonuses, overtime, and tips are excluded and can add 20-40% to real total compensation.
